RSGx are excited to announce that we have been awarded with the Signalling ESDS (Essential Services Distribution System) Delivery Package of Works, as part of the Additional Works Package 6 project area (AWP6) on the Southern Program Alliance (SPA) project. The SPA project is a section of the $6 billion Level Crossings Removal Project, in Melbourne, Victoria, which involves the removal of 75 level crossings, of which 2 are included in AWP6 at Warrigal Road and Parkers road.

The AWP6 package involves building a viaduct that goes over a road and has an approximate length of 1,150m, as well as replacing all the existing track formation and overhead infrastructure for a stretch of about 2.3km between project limits on the track.

It also includes creating a new local Parkdale Station with a platform on each side, supported by the substructure of the rail viaduct, and constructing civil infrastructure such as footpaths, shared use paths, carparks and drainage.

RSGx have been tasked with the removal of AWP6 enabling assets and the installation of the Essential Services Distribution System (ESDS) and bonding requirements for the final stage of AWP 6 rail signalling works which includes:

  • Removal of all redundant Signalling cables, HV cables, signalling and HV trackside equipment and redundant cables.
  • Installation of Bonding requirements as per Bonding Plans
  • Cable Hauling for new 3C 35mm cables
  • Inspection and acceptance of all XIRIA Switchgear, transformers and switchboards.
  • Supply and installation of compromise joints, HV XIRIA switchgear and associated equipment including SCADA RTU cabinets.
  • Installation of transformers, switchboards, earth bars and earthing and of all signage.
  • Termination of test earths to 110V switchboards.
  • Routing of cables from switchgear to SCADA panels.
  • LV Cabling including pulling, termination and testing.
  • HV cable installation between switchgear and transformers including termination and testing (incl VLF testing).
  • Supply and termination/jointing of HV terminations of all HV cables.
  • Termination of three temporary generators plus the Certificate of Electrical Safety.
  • Testing of all HV and LV cables.
  • Installation of COMS conduits at VicTrack cabinet on HV box.
  • Installation of fibre patch leads to VicTrack junction box.
  • Installation of shrouds for VicTrack cabinet and 110V SB on both HV and Signalling boxes.
  • Installation of VLD boards, cabling, terminations and testing.
  • Completion of all quality documents including ITPs and check sheets.
  • Removal of all redundant equipment and cables.
  • Testing and Commissioning of switchgear, SCADA operations and energise into service.
